Former AFL player and media presenter Warren Tredrea has been given a deadline — by 4 pm Tuesday — to pay $149,000 to the Nine Network (Channel 9) as legal costs tied to his failed unfair dismissal claims and subsequent appeal. If he doesn’t pay or arrange a payment plan, Channel 9 can begin insolvency proceedings against him

PORT Adelaide will be cautious with Jason Horne-Francis ahead of round one, with the star midfielder needing to get through the next month to prove his availability after an injury-hit pre-season.

Horne-Francis had foot surgery in November and has been on a modified training program and last week had a knock to his shoulder that’ll stop him being involved in the Power’s intra club this week.

Power coach Josh Carr told AFL.com.au that the former Kangaroo would play some game time in next week's match simulation with Adelaide, but that he wasn't yet locked in to face North Melbourne for their season-opener.

wenchbarwer wrote:I hope they don't ruin Ramm by playing him too early, he's at least another year off I reckon
Harris Andrews spent the first few of years of his career getting embarrassed, coinciding with Brisbane being an extremely bad football team. Fast forward 10 years and he is the best fullback in the league and has captained B2B flags.

Sav & BZT won't be a feature in a couple of years, so the decision to get games into Ramm might look a bit silly now, but the decision to get 40 games into him as early as possible (responsibly, of course), may very well bear significant fruit in 5-7 years time.

Fair point, but I can't really remember Andrews getting embarrassed as much as I remember the Lions being woeful back then.

His numbers in his rookie year (11.6 disposals, 5.3 marks and 1.5 tackles and a Rising Star nomination) line up pretty well with career numbers (13.2, 6.6 & 1.4).

I'm all for the promotion of youth, provided they're ready. Andrews clearly was.
